Oracle系列:(16)分页
发表于:2025-01-22 作者:千家信息网编辑
千家信息网最后更新 2025年01月22日,回顾mysql分页用limit关键字查询users表中前二条记录select * from users limit 0,2或select * from users limit 2;0表示第一条记录的索
千家信息网最后更新 2025年01月22日Oracle系列:(16)分页
回顾mysql分页 用limit关键字 查询users表中前二条记录 select * from users limit 0,2 或 select * from users limit 2; 0表示第一条记录的索引号,索引号从0开始 2表示最多选取二个记录 查询出users前三条记录 select * from users limit 0,3 或 select * from users limit 3 查询出users第2条到第4条记录 select * from users limit 1,3; |
回顾hibernate分页API Query.setFirstResult(0);Query.setMaxResult(3); |
什么是rownum,有何特点
1)rownum是oracle专用的关健字
2)rownum与表在一起,表亡它亡,表在它在
3)rownum在默认情况下,从表中是查不出来的
4)只有在select子句中,明确写出rownum才能显示出来
5)rownum是number类型,且唯一连续
6)rownum最小值是1,最大值与你的记录条数相同
7)rownum也能参与关系运算
* rownum = 1 有值
* rownum < 5 有值
* rownum <=5 有值
* rownum > 2 无值
* rownum >=2 无值
* rownum <>2 有值 与 rownum < 2 相同
* rownum = 2 无值
8)基于rownum的特性,我们通常rownum只用于<或<=关系运算
显示emp表中3-8条记录(方式一:使用集合减运算)
select rownum "伪列",emp.* from emp where rownum<=8minusselect rownum,emp.* from emp where rownum<=2;
显示emp表中2-8条记录(方式二:使用子查询,在from子句中使用,重点)
select xx.*from (select rownum ids,emp.* from emp where rownum<=8) xx where ids>=2;
注意:在子查询中的别名,不可加""引号
显示emp表中5-9条记录
select yy.*from (select rownum ids,emp.* from emp where rownum<=9) yywhere ids>=5;
注意:在项目中,from后面可能有真实表名,也可能用子查询看作的表名,
同时真实表和子查询看作的表要做连接查询
查询
运算
相同
子句
方式
索引
索引号
最大
最小
关键
关键字
别名
只有
同时
引号
情况
最大值
特性
特点
类型
数据库的安全要保护哪些东西
数据库安全各自的含义是什么
生产安全数据库录入
数据库的安全性及管理
数据库安全策略包含哪些
海淀数据库安全审计系统
建立农村房屋安全信息数据库
易用的数据库客户端支持安全管理
连接数据库失败ssl安全错误
数据库的锁怎样保障安全
北京网络安全保障总队电话
网络安全方面有哪些股票
东阿软件开发者
群晖docker如何连接数据库
网络安全法网站被黑处罚
奶块vivo的服务器叫什么
生产产品数据库设计入门经典
数据库api接口下载
数据库安全与完整性要求
linux软件开发面试题
数据库应用第三章习题
软件开发设计找私活
网络技术:北京建站
网络安全的重要意义作文
软件开发收入税率是多少
计算机网络技术湖北专升本
涟源租房软件开发
2020网络安全管理现状
网络安全存在哪些问题图片
动图数据库
张掖青少年网络安全知识竞赛
关于KFC数据库管理技术
性价比好的重庆移动服务器租用
非vca安全服务器
重庆共生网络技术服务
数据库一条记录多少kb
数据库中怎么存放头像
如何清理数据库服务器空间
软件开发植入app
网络安全顾问年薪最高的人